Lincoln has a relatively low overall natural hazard risk rating according to FEMA's National Risk Index. The top hazard risks are winter weather, ice storm, lightning. The area has had 22 federal disaster declarations. The most common disaster type is flood (6 declarations). 238 flood insurance claims have been filed in the area. FEMA has obligated $86,268,698 in public assistance recovery funding.
